findbugs: String to byt[] conversion

decodeBase64() can work on String so the unsafe conversion is not needed

Signed-off-by: Rohit Yadav <rohit.yadav@shapeblue.com>

This closes #361
This commit is contained in:
Daan Hoogland 2015-06-06 10:43:20 +02:00 committed by Rohit Yadav
parent 39d51bc021
commit 14d9c82369

View File

@ -2292,7 +2292,7 @@ public class NetworkModelImpl extends ManagerBase implements NetworkModel {
final List<String[]> vmData = new ArrayList<String[]>();
if (userData != null) {
vmData.add(new String[]{"userdata", "user-data", new String(Base64.decodeBase64(userData.getBytes()))});
vmData.add(new String[]{"userdata", "user-data", new String(Base64.decodeBase64(userData))});
}
vmData.add(new String[]{"metadata", "service-offering", StringUtils.unicodeEscape(serviceOffering)});
vmData.add(new String[]{"metadata", "availability-zone", StringUtils.unicodeEscape(zoneName)});